switch
Initiates an editing session in which to change switch configuration settings. The
system displays each parameter one line at a time and prompts you for a value.
For each parameter, enter a new value or press the Enter key to accept the
current value shown in brackets. Table A-20 describes the Set Config Switch
parameters.
Table A-19. Security Configuration Parameters
Parameter Description
AutoSave Enables (True) or disables (False) the saving of changes
to active security set in the switch’s permanent memory.
The default is True.
FabricBindingEnabled Enables (True) or disables (False) the configuration and
enforcement of fabric binding on all switches the fabric.
Fabric binding associates switch worldwide names with a
domain ID in the creation of ISL groups.
Table A-20. Set Config Switch Parameters
Parameter Description
AdminState Switch administrative state: online, offline, or
diagnostics. The default is Online.
BroadcastEnabled Broadcast. Enables (True) or disables (False)
forwarding of broadcast frames. The default is True.
InbandEnabled Inband management. Enables (True) or disables
(False) the ability to manage the switch over an ISL.
The default is True.
FDMIEnabled Fabric Device Monitoring Interface. Enables (True) or
disables (False) the monitoring of target and initiator
device information. The default is True.
FDMIEntries The number of device entries to maintain in the FDMI
database. Enter a number from 0–1000. The default
is 1000.
DefaultDomainID Default domain ID. The default is 1.
DomainIDLock Prevents (True) or allows (False) dynamic
reassignment of the domain ID. The default is False.
